Tshering Bhote, Jyamchang Bhote and Pemba Gyaljen Sherpa have been climbing lots of new peaks in Langtang region this season, and have also climbed the longest waterfall ice in Himalaya, Kwangde waterfall. At 20 full pitches, the climb was 750m vertical, grade WI 5. This is the first Nepali ascent and it was done in 24 hours non-stop Namche and back to Namche.
